From Cindy's 1994 self-titled album, this song was later recorded by Regina Belle in 1998. Vocalist/Performer Cindy Mizelle is a treat for everybody who enjoys listening to great vocals. She has toured with, recorded with, and has an extensive background in the Music Business.

@MrChicago891 I was programmer in college back when this album was issued. I've Had Enough was the first single and it charted into the mid 40's on the R&B charts (maybe a little higher). The second single was "Because of You". It dented the bottom of the charts and fell off after a few weeks. I can't remember how high the album actually charted, but it was low (maybe a mid 40's debut and descended off the charts). 'charts' refers to Billboard R&B Charts.

@MrChicago891 I remember wanting to give 'Because of You' a full 16-week programming run, but my Elektra rep ask me to drop it since the album was no longer being worked by the time the cd promo for that second single reached radio. I remember him saying the Cindy was pissed b/c Elektra let her project go to focus on Anita's upcoming (at the time) Rhythm of Love cd (and Anita was pissed at the overall performance of R.O.L, too).
